编程学什么最吃香专业男
-
在当今信息化时代,编程能力已经成为各行业专业人才的必备技能之一。无论是互联网行业还是传统行业,都需要有编程能力的人才来支持和推动业务的发展。因此,编程技能成为了当下最吃香的专业技能之一。那么,在编程领域中,学习什么最吃香呢?
-
前端开发
随着互联网行业的不断发展,网页开发已经成为了一种基本的需求。前端开发主要负责网页的用户界面设计和交互逻辑实现,是构建用户界面的关键环节。掌握前端开发技术,如HTML、CSS、JavaScript等,能够制作出美观且用户体验良好的界面,是很受欢迎的技能。 -
后端开发
后端开发是网站和应用程序的核心部分,主要负责处理服务器与数据库之间的交互,实现网站和应用程序的逻辑和功能。掌握后端开发技术,如Java、Python、PHP等,能够开发出高效、安全且具有良好扩展性的服务端应用,受到了广泛的关注。 -
数据科学与人工智能
数据科学与人工智能是当今最具前景的领域之一。数据科学主要通过数据挖掘和分析,发现数据中蕴含的有价值的信息,为决策提供支持。人工智能则致力于模拟人类智能,实现机器自动化的思考和学习能力。掌握数据科学和人工智能的技术,如数据分析、机器学习、深度学习等,将有更多的机会参与到一些前沿科技项目中。 -
移动应用开发
随着智能手机的普及,移动应用开发领域也日益受到关注。掌握移动应用开发技术,如Android开发、iOS开发等,能够开发出适配不同平台的移动应用,满足用户日益增长的移动需求。
综上所述,前端开发、后端开发、数据科学与人工智能以及移动应用开发是目前最吃香的编程专业技能。掌握这些技术,将会有更多机会获得就业机会和发展空间。不过,编程学习是一个持续不断的过程,只有不断学习和实践,才能不断提升自己的编程能力。
1年前 -
-
学习什么编程语言最吃香,对于专业男来说,这是一个非常重要的问题。在当今数字化时代,编程已经成为了一个非常热门的职业选择。以下是学习最吃香的五种编程语言。
-
Python: Python是一种简单且易于学习的编程语言,它被广泛应用于数据分析、人工智能和机器学习等领域。Python拥有丰富的库和资源,使得开发者能够快速构建出高效的应用程序。因此,Python编程技能对于专业男来说是非常吃香的。
-
JavaScript: JavaScript是一种用于网页开发的脚本语言。它能够为网页添加互动性和动态效果,因此对于前端开发者来说非常重要。随着移动应用的兴起,JavaScript也逐渐在移动应用开发中被广泛应用。掌握JavaScript编程技能能够让专业男在网页和移动应用开发领域获得更多机会。
-
Java: Java是一种广泛应用于企业级应用开发的编程语言。它的跨平台性和安全性使得Java成为了很多大型公司的首选。掌握Java编程技能可以为专业男提供丰富的职业发展机会,并为他们进入企业级应用开发领域铺平道路。
-
C++: C++是一种面向对象的编程语言,它被广泛应用于系统开发、游戏开发和嵌入式系统等领域。C++编程技能对于专业男来说非常吃香,因为它可以让他们参与到更底层的开发工作中,并为他们提供更高级别的控制能力。
-
Ruby: Ruby是一种简洁而优雅的编程语言,它被广泛应用于Web开发和Ruby on Rails框架。Ruby的简洁语法和丰富的库使得开发者能够快速构建出高效的Web应用程序。掌握Ruby编程技能可以为专业男在Web开发领域获得更多机会。
总结起来,学习Python、JavaScript、Java、C++和Ruby这五种编程语言对于专业男来说是最吃香的。无论是数据科学、前端开发、企业级应用开发还是系统开发,掌握这些编程技能都能为专业男提供广阔的职业发展机会。然而,不同人的兴趣和职业目标可能不同,所以专业男应该根据自己的兴趣和职业目标选择适合自己的编程语言进行学习。
1年前 -
-
在编程领域,目前最吃香的专业应该是人工智能(AI)与大数据。这两个领域近年来发展迅猛,对于各行各业都有着深远的影响。下面将详细介绍人工智能与大数据的相关内容,以及学习这两个专业的方法和操作流程。
一、人工智能(AI)
人工智能是一门研究如何使计算机能够像人一样思考、学习和决策的学科。AI的发展离不开机器学习、深度学习等技术的支持。学习人工智能需要具备以下几个关键技能:
1.1 机器学习
机器学习是指通过算法和统计模型,使计算机能够自动从数据中学习和改进性能的方法。学习机器学习需要了解各种经典的机器学习算法,如线性回归、决策树、支持向量机等,并学会如何使用相关的数据处理、特征工程以及模型评估方法。
1.2 深度学习
深度学习是指通过神经网络模型,模仿人脑的神经结构和功能,实现对复杂数据的自动学习和分析。学习深度学习需要了解神经网络的基本原理、常用的深度学习模型(如卷积神经网络、循环神经网络等),以及相关的优化算法和工具(如梯度下降、反向传播、TensorFlow等)。
1.3 自然语言处理
自然语言处理是指让计算机理解和处理人类语言的技术。学习自然语言处理需要了解语言处理的基本原理,如词法分析、句法分析、语义分析等,以及相关的语言模型和算法(如词嵌入、循环神经网络等)。
1.4 强化学习
强化学习是指通过不断试错和反馈,使智能体能够在环境中学习和优化行为策略的方法。学习强化学习需要了解马尔可夫决策过程(Markov Decision Process,简称MDP)的基本概念和算法,以及相关的增强学习方法(如Q-learning、深度强化学习等)。
学习人工智能的方法和操作流程如下:
1.明确学习目标,选择合适的学习路径。可以通过报名参加相关的学校课程,或者自主学习在线课程、教程等。
2.建立坚实的数学和统计基础,包括线性代数、概率论、统计学等。
3.学习编程基础知识,掌握至少一种主流的编程语言,如Python、Java等。
4.深入学习机器学习、深度学习等相关的技术和算法,理解其原理和应用。
5.进行实践项目,通过解决实际问题来巩固学习成果。
二、大数据
大数据是指规模巨大、复杂多变的数据集合,对数据的采集、存储、分析和应用提出了巨大的挑战。在大数据时代,学习大数据技术成为一项非常重要的技能。下面介绍学习大数据的关键技术和方法:
2.1 数据采集和处理
学习大数据技术需要了解数据采集和处理的方法。其中包括结构化数据的采集、清洗和转换,以及非结构化数据(如文本、图像、音频等)的抽取和处理。
2.2 数据存储和管理
学习大数据技术需要了解大数据存储和管理的方法。常见的大数据存储技术包括分布式文件系统(如Hadoop的HDFS)、分布式数据库(如HBase、Cassandra等)以及NoSQL数据库(如MongoDB、Redis等)。
2.3 数据分析和挖掘
学习大数据技术需要掌握数据分析和挖掘的方法。其中包括数据可视化、关联规则挖掘、聚类分析、分类预测等技术。
2.4 机器学习和数据挖掘
学习大数据技术需要了解机器学习和数据挖掘的方法。机器学习可以通过算法和模型,挖掘出数据中的潜在模式和关联规律,实现数据的智能分析和预测。
学习大数据的方法和操作流程如下:
1.了解大数据的基本概念和背景,明确学习目标。
2.建立数学和统计基础,掌握数据分析和挖掘的基本方法和模型。
3.学习大数据平台和工具,如Hadoop、Spark等。
4.进行实践项目,通过处理和分析实际的大数据,巩固学习成果。
总结起来,人工智能与大数据是目前最吃香的专业,学习这两个领域需要掌握相关的技术和算法。通过选择合适的学习路径和进行实践项目,可以逐步掌握专业知识和技能,从而在编程领域中立于不败之地。
1年前